Wireframe is a low-fidelity visual blueprint that defines the layout, structure, and user flow of your application without design details or functionality. Wireframes focus on information architecture and navigation paths, typically created using simple shapes, text labels, and basic annotations. They answer: "Where does each element go, and how do users move through the interface?" Wireframes are fast to create, cost-effective, and ideal for early-stage validation with stakeholders and users.
Prototype is an interactive, medium-to-high-fidelity representation of your product that simulates user interactions and workflows. Unlike wireframes, prototypes include visual design elements, typography, colors, and clickable interactions that let users experience the product's core functionality without backend logic. Prototypes bridge the gap between static designs and full development, enabling realistic user testing, feedback collection, and design refinement before engineering begins.
MVP (Minimum Viable Product) is a fully functional, production-ready application with the essential features needed to solve a specific user problem and generate business value. An MVP includes working backend systems, databases, authentication, real user data, and deployment infrastructure. It is released to real users in the market to validate business assumptions, gather authentic user feedback, and drive measurable outcomes like user adoption, retention, and revenue.
Key Differences: Wireframes focus on structure and layout; prototypes demonstrate interaction and visual design; MVPs deliver working functionality and business results. Wireframes cost hundreds to thousands of dollars, prototypes range from thousands to tens of thousands, and MVPs require substantial investment in development, deployment, and ongoing support. The progression from wireframe to prototype to MVP reduces risk, validates assumptions early, and ensures your development investment aligns with user needs and market demand.
